Keyword Sponsorship
Keyword Sponsorship Web Site Marketing - Targeted keyword sponsorship allows a business to buy an important keyword or keyword phrase. Every time someone searches for that word or phrase, the sponsor’s listing appears as a highlighted search listing at the top of the results page. This type of web site marketing is very expensive – thousands of dollars a month for the most popular phrases – because you pay to be listed whether or not your listing is clicked.
Web Site Marketing: Pay-Per-Click Advertising
Pay-Per-Click Web Site Marketing - Pay-per-click web site marketing is a less expensive means of selectively targeting an audience via web site marketing, but it requires bidding in an open auction to secure the top listings which appear as highlighted textboxes on the right side of a search results page.
This type of web site marketing is fairly cost-effective because you only pay when someone clicks on your web site marketing ad to view your website and you can set monthly expenditure maximums to fit your web site marketing budget during a test period. You can also easily calculate your ROI with this type of web site marketing program.
However, to maintain the top keyword positions for your pay-per-click web site marketing campaign, you need to constantly monitor the current auction prices and adjust your bid as necessary, which can be very time-consuming. Also, with the rapidly rising popularity of this type of web site marketing program, the bidding price for popular keywords and phrases can go as high as several dollars per click, whether or not that click turns into a qualified lead or sale. In addition, a pay-per-click ad is subject to abuse by unscrupulous searchers and your competitors, which can be costly.
Web Site Optimization / Search Engine Optimization
Web Site Optimization / Search Engine Optimization - Web site or search engine optimization is an art and science that has been misrepresented during the last few years. Though many people who make their living optimizing websites would tell you that they know all of the tricks to obtaining high rankings on Google and the other major search engines, no tricks exist to help you obtain the best rankings for your company’s most important keywords.
Tricks will only get you permanently blacklisted by Google. Successful optimization for web site marketing combines known methods of coding a web page (science) with a writing style (art) that integrates the results of extensive web site marketing research (science) to determine the best web site marketing keywords and phrases to target, along with a compelling story (art) about your expertise.
Other factors, such as the number of other web sites residing on your host server, the number of external links to your site and the frequency with which site maintenance is performed, also contribute to high search engine rankings.
